ABOUT THE NETWORK+
CompTIA is the world leader in vendor-neutral IT certification exams. Every year hundreds of thousands of students take their exams in order to start their IT career or verify knowledge they already possess.

CompTIA certification is highly valued by hundreds of companies and, in fact, many insist on CompTIA qualifications before hiring. Companies such as Apple, Canon, Dell, Fujitsu, HP, IBM, Toshiba, Unisys, and the U.S. Department of Defense will not consider an IT job application without relevant CompTIA certification.

Network+ is the perfect qualification for anybody considering a career in internetworking. It covers many of the basic principles numerous engineers seem to skip, such as subnetting, TCP/IP, troubleshooting, and topologies. These knowledge gaps can cost you dearly in job interviews or when there is a network emergency.

ABOUT THE AUTHORS
Paul Browning - MCSE,A+,Net+, CCNP used to work at Cisco TAC but left in 2002 to start his own Cisco training company. He has authored several Cisco manuals as well as created one of the biggest online Cisco training websites used by many thousands of students.

Daniel Gheorghe is a CCIE in Routing and Switching. He is currently preparing for his second CCIE certification (in Security) and he is developing his skills in system penetration testing. He also holds numerous certifications in networking and security, from Cisco and other vendors, including CCNA, CCDA, CCNA Security, CCNP, CCDP, CCIP, FCNSA, FCNSP, and CEH. He took an interest in IT at an early age and soon developed a passion for computer networking, which made him study hard in order to reach an expert level.
